Taking Pressure and Temperature Readings
❚To take pressure and temperature readings
In the Timekeeping Mode, Compass Mode, or Altitude Mode, press the B button to enter the Pressure/Temperature Mode. The display will show the barometric pressure and pressure tendency graph, and temperature.

•The barometric pressure can take up to four or five seconds to appear after you enter the Pressure/Temperature Mode.
Barometric Pressure and Temperature Readings
After you enter the Pressure/Temperature Mode, the watch takes readings every five seconds for three minutes. After that, the watch will take a reading whenever you press the B button.
•When measuring outdoor temperatures, remove the watch from your wrist and place it in a location where its readings will not affected by body temperature, sweat (water droplets), direct sunlight, etc.
Pressure Tendency Graph
The pressure tendency graph shows the results of barometric pressure readings that are taken automatically every two hours.
If you do not perform any button operation for two or three minutes while in the Pressure/Temperature Mode, the watch will return to the Timekeeping Mode automatically.

The pressure differential graphic shows the relative difference between the barometric pressure reading taken when you enter the Pressure/Temperature Mode and the last of the readings the watch takes every two hours.
•The graphic shows changes up to ±15hPa, in 1hPa units.
•You can turn display of the pressure differential graphic off, if you want.
